I currently also needed an image with accelerated framebuffer (so I could
run Qt5 eglfs on it) on wandboard-dual. I followed those instructions:
http://wiki.wandboard.org/index.php/Building_Qt5_using_yocto_on_Wandboard ,
with some modifications. I suggest you to do:
- add DISTRO_FEATURES_remove = "x11 wayland"
- add IMAGE_INSTALL_append = " gpu-viv-bin-mx6q "
Then I bitbaked core-image-minimal and it has libGAL, libEGL (and so on) in
framebuffer version.

> >> Yes so it is expected to not be accelerated in Framebuffer backend as by
> >> default it will use X11 backend. Blame Vivante to make those
> non-parallel
> >> :-( So please add to your local.conf: DISTRO_FEATURES_remove = "x11
> wayland"
> >> remove your tmp dir and build your image again.
> >
> >
> > Which target would you expect I should use when I remove "x11 wayland"?
> > fsl-image-x11 (fails)
> > fsl-image-gui (fails)
> > fsl-image-test (currently building, will know tomorrow)
> > core-image-x11
>
> core-image-base and add the recipe you wish. Faster and easier to debug.
